Default Bad Luck or Bad Play?

Need quick analysis if this was correct play or not. UB $5 rebuy last night, started w/ 250 people, after 1st break, down to about 130, huge prize pool w/ all the rebuys ($1000 for 1st) I did not rebuy or add on. I'm up to about 3k. Before the cards are dealt, some guy says he's has to leave and is going all in (this is before the cards are dealt) I'm dealt poket 9's. I call the BB to see what he does, he goes all-in, it's folded to me. I call (figure 9's are better than a random hand). Guy after me calls too. We all have approx. same amount of chips. I was very excited to see them turn over 8-4os and K-9os respectively. However, flop comes 8-4-2, turn 5, river K. I lose the big main pot and the small side pot. If I win, I'm top 5 in chip leaders, and i play conservatively, so it would have lasted. Was this the right play, or a chance I should have stayed away from. Your advice is appreciated.
